Output 76a968e34c5dc78dc2e35c4aef53ba74a1d344b35044715eb5da66139b052bdc:99

value
21141936
script pubkey
OP_0 OP_PUSHBYTES_20 12af2a314acb0da00b8de074ebc9e523f28df203
address
bc1qz2hj5v22evx6qzudup6whj09y0egmusr89d77c
transaction
76a968e34c5dc78dc2e35c4aef53ba74a1d344b35044715eb5da66139b052bdc
spent
true